Briony Richards

Associate

Briony is an Associate in the Employment team.

briony-richards

About

Briony provides day-to-day HR support and guidance to a variety of employers across a range of sectors such as fast-food, sport and healthcare. 

She represents both claimants and respondents on litigation in the Employment Tribunal, including claims relating to unfair dismissal, whistleblowing, equal pay and discrimination and has experience lodging appeals in the Employment Appeals Tribunal.  Briony also has experience in Data Subject Access Requests, preparing policies and staff handbooks, drafting contracts of employment and advising in relation to settlement agreements. 

With a background in mathematics and computing, Briony is highly numerate and can quickly grasp complex technical issues, while always remaining commercially minded.  

In addition to her advisory role, Briony writes articles for online and national publications on topical employment law issues.  She regularly delivers employment law training sessions to clients, both in house and by webinar.

Briony is a member of the Association of European Lawyers (AEL) Employment Special Interest Group, connecting her to leading employment lawyers across Europe.

Experience

  • Advising a leading Formula One team on an ongoing basis in respect of day-to-day employee issues and specific projects, including collective redundancy.
  • Achieving favourable settlements in a variety of Employment Tribunal claims, including for sexual harassment, unfair dismissal and disability discrimination, on behalf of a large client in the fast food industry.
  • Successfully negotiating a substantial settlement for an individual in a maternity discrimination case.
